    Re: Recommendation Light Set For Moss Tank

    For my experience,

    Use 2X39watt T5HO for your 3ft moss tank. Just make sure the tubes are rated for plants usage etc 6500K-7000K or even ADA 8000K but it won't make your moss grow faster as after all it is still just moss.

    If your tank is intense with lots of moss, then I would suggest you using 4X39watt T5HO for your tank and hang it up higher away from the water surface etc 12cm apart to prevent algae growing on the tank glass.

    I have moss in every single condition before and no matter what light u use, it would not matter. If you only intending to plant moss, led would be good cause it's less intense and thus less algae issue. If you use t5 light or t8, there will be advantage too as if u want to upgrade to other plants which need more light, you do not have to change the lightset but there might be more algae, so if not using led light, I suggest max 6 hrs of light if not easy get algae.
